Hey guys, I was out diving a few days ago and i was into some 1910 - 1920s kinda stuff. I was finding all sorts of things such as inks, medecines, codds and then i found these two crown top beers. The fist bottle on the left in the pic is embossed with Becks Buffalo NY. It is pink glass and has 13 fl. oz embossed on the base. The second beer bottle to the right in the pic is embossed with Jacob Ruppert's New York Lager Beer (trade mark R logo). On the bottom is embossed "this bottle is registered not to be sold". This bottle is amber. They are both in great condition, no cracks chips nothing. I have tried looking on the internet and several books of mine and i have found nothing on these bottles. Would anyone have any sort of info on these bottles? Date, value, history etc. Thanks for looking.
